I agree with the sentiment in general, that code has been left there rotting, making it more visible
might spur some interest in it.
However there lies the issue... it's getting moved from a module that's officially unsupported, to
one that is, and while it's still incomplete in functionality.

I think we first need to sort out the maintenance of it. If Matthijs Laan wants to be the maintainer of it, then it can be moved, otherwise it makes little sense to do so. And if he does, he should speak to what level he intends to do so. If he's gonna bring it functionally on par with the rest of GML parsers, then it can belong to gt-xml, otherwise it's probably best if it stays in unsupported, in its own module.

    On 06-05-2021 10:55, Matthijs Laan via GeoTools-Devel wrote:
    >
    > The internal StAX GML parser from the wfs-ng module would be
    useful as a
    > public API as it is much simpler and faster than the GTXML parsers,
    > although the latter supports more GML elements.
    >
    > Beside the GTXML parsers there is also a SAX GML parser in gt-xml,
    > package org.geotools.gml.
    >
    > Would it be a good idea to move the
    XmlSimpleFeatureParser.parseGeom()
    > method to the gt-xml module in a package like
    org.geotools.gml.stream,
    > or better to create a new module like
    modules/unsupported/gml-streaming?
    >
    > Moving it to gt-xml would mean no dependencies would change for
    wfs-ng.
    > On the other hand gt-xml also contains a SAX based SLD parser
    but a StAX
    > SLD parser is in a separate ysld module.
    >
    > In addition to making it a public API, it is also a good
    opportunity to
    > reduce code duplication in XmlSimpleFeatureParser and
    > XmlComplexFeatureParser. The latter descends from
    XmlFeatureParser which
    > has duplicated parseGeom() methods which have already diverged
    because
    > in GEOT-6835 / #3393 MultiCurve support was added to one but not
    the
    > other. Some more GML support for Arcs etc. could also be added.
    >
    > Either way is a simple tasks moving some code around, I can make
    a PR
    > for it.
    >
